  2. Apr 9, 2024 · Codecademy Pro is a paid subscription that helps you develop the skills and experience to land a job in tech. You can choose between two billing options: $39.99/month when paid monthly. $239.88 when paid annually – that’s $19.99/month, saving you $240 compared to 12 months with the monthly billing cycle.

  6. Aug 20, 2020 · SQL. SQL (pronounced “sequel”) is a data-driven programming language. Its purpose is to store information into separate data sets so you can retrieve them to generate accurate reports based on your search query. SQL is an absolute must for any aspiring Data Scientist, given that data science uses relational databases.
